Extensive abrasions are found all over the body of a pedestrian lying by the road side. What is the likely cause?
Correct Answer: Secondary injury
Description: The synopsis of forensic medicine & toxicology ;Dr k.s narayan reddy; 28th edition ;pg,no. 148 There is extensive abrasion all over the body of the victim more over the victim was a pedestrian so it may be caused by striking the ground ,rather than the vehicle itself hence it must be a secondary injury .
